Principal Software Engineer @ DDN Storage | Jobright.ai
JOBSarrow
RecommendedLiked
0
Applied
0
External
0
Principal Software Engineer jobs in United States
Be an early applicantLess than 25 applicants
expire-info-iconThis job has closed.
company-logo

DDN Storage · 9 hours ago

Principal Software Engineer

ftfMaximize your interview chances
Artificial Intelligence (AI)Big Data
check
H1B Sponsor Likelynote

Insider Connection @DDN Storage

Discover valuable connections within the company who might provide insights and potential referrals.
Get 3x more responses when you reach out via email instead of LinkedIn.

Responsibilities

Design and implement lightweight publisher/subscriber event streaming broker architecture, integrating with complex highly resilient underlying distributed storage.
Drive design discussions, build prototypes and contribute to deliver high quality products.
Conduct code reviews and improve scalability, reliability and performance of RED solutions.
Collaborate with your teammates and integrate a group of passionate developers in an outcome-oriented environment.

Qualification

Find out how your skills align with this job's requirements. If anything seems off, you can easily click on the tags to select or unselect skills to reflect your actual expertise.

AI-based rules enginesPub/sub event streamingC/C++ programmingLinux/UNIX environmentsApache KafkaMosquittoDistributed file systemsParallel file systemsScale-out storage solutionsHigh availability storageNVM storage technologyDistributed key-value storageNVME storage technologyLinux kernel internalsAsynchronous replicationSynchronous replicationHierarchical Storage ManagementLow-latency HPC networksMemory mapped IOEvent-driven programmingLock-free programming

Required

Prior experience with architecture and implementation of AI-based rules engines to facilitate data movement and transformation.
Experience with architecture and implementation of lightweight pub/sub event streaming technologies (ex. Apache Kafka, Mosquitto)
Knowledge of distributed file system solutions, parallel file system solutions or network file system is important.
Knowledge of various traditional data movement technologies including asynchronous replication, synchronous replication, and tiering
Experience in developing and debugging at system level C/C++, particularly for Linux/UNIX computing environments.
Excellent hands-on software development experience of 10+ years on scale-out and high availability storage solutions
BS/MS/Ph.D in Computer Science, Computer Engineering, Statistics, Mathematics or equivalent degree/experience.
Attention to detail and commitment to high quality deliverables.
Strong team player with good communication skills and should be self-starter.
Excellent time management skills, with the ability to independently prioritize, multitask, and work under deadlines in a fast-paced environment.

Preferred

NVM storage technology and/or distributed key-value storage systems are highly desired.
Common Hierarchical Storage Management techniques including tiering as well as efficient data movement techniques from edge to core to cloud.
Parallel file system solutions (ex. Lustre, GPFS) or distributed file systems (ex. NFS)
Low-latency, high-bandwidth High-Performance Computing (HPC) networks
NVME and NVMEoF storage technology
Linux kernel internals
Memory mapped IO (mmap), event-driven and lock-free programming concepts
Distributed key-value storage systems (memcached)

Company

DDN Storage

twittertwittertwitter
company-logo
DDN is the world’s largest private data storage company and the leading provider of intelligent technology and infrastructure solutions for data-centric organizations.

H1B Sponsorship

DDN Storage has a track record of offering H1B sponsorships. Please note that this does not guarantee sponsorship for this specific role. Below presents additional info for your reference. (Data Powered by US Department of Labor)
Distribution of Different Job Fields Receiving Sponsorship
Represents job field similar to this job
Trends of Total Sponsorships
2023 (1)
2022 (1)
2021 (6)

Funding

Current Stage
Late Stage
Total Funding
$9.9M
2002-01-02Series A· $9.9M

Leadership Team

leader-logo
Alex Bouzari
Co-Founder, Chairman, & CEO
linkedin
P
Paul Bloch
President and Co-Founder
linkedin
Company data provided by crunchbase
logo

Orion

Your AI Copilot